The Korean Cultural Center, Los Angeles sponsored the very special event for the Korean Community in Los Angeles at the Ford Amphitheatre on July 22nd, 2010. The Ford Theatres, a part of the program of the LA county Arts Commission, is a historic facility whose offerings reflect the diversity of Los Angeles. In its continuing effort to broaden those offerings, the Ford wanted to become acquainted with Korean and Korean-American producers, performers, artists, and theatre troupes to learn about their needs and introduce them to the venue.
 
50 guests joined with lively conversation with fellow artists, producers, and Ford staff. There was a sneak peek of Born Dance Company - New Breath: Korean Dance Fusion performance which is the part of the Ford’s 2010 Summer Season. The guests also took an intimate, behind-the-scenes tour of the Ford Theatres, saw the production capabilities.
